sibyllic

/sɪˈbɪlɪk/
adjective
  1. Relating to or characteristic of a sibyl; prophetic, oracular (variant spelling of sibylic).
    • Her sibyllic advice often turned out to be surprisingly accurate.
    • The painting had a sibyllic quality, as if the figure knew secrets of the future.
    • The sibyllic utterances of the fortune-teller were hard to understand.
